Output 0628d3d2109cc783fe1a1d9932d7728bdbbc0a0a6c8061ad863d58f13a8c22bb:17

value
1676864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2043e8d25556ca7eec88503dbeafc5f09fb6db0 OP_EQUAL
address
3KNt6fHMxy3mhwmt66DjqFVsPhXWTVAcrf
transaction
0628d3d2109cc783fe1a1d9932d7728bdbbc0a0a6c8061ad863d58f13a8c22bb
spent
true